Jakarta Disburses Social Assistance for KLJ, KPDJ and KAJ Phase III

The Jakarta Social Agency (Dinsos) has disbursed social assistance funds to the targeted holders of Jakarta Elderly Card (KLJ), Jakarta Disabled Card (KPDJ) and Jakarta Child Card (KAJ). It has been able to make phase III fund withdrawals through Bank DKI ATMs since September 28.

There are 77,517 KLJ recipients, 11,373 KPDJ recipients, and 9,340 KAJ recipients

"There are 77,517 KLJ recipients, 11,373 KPDJ recipients, and 9,340 KAJ recipients," detailed Dinkes Head, Premi Lasari, Wednesday (9/29).

He explained, there were a number of data taken out in the third phase of disbursement, with details as many as 652 KLJ recipients, 49 KPDJ recipients and 191 KAJ. It was the result of an update after the disbursement in Phase II (April-June 2021).

"Data updating is done when the beneficiary has died or moved outside Jakarta area," he explained.

He added, KLJ recipients received assistance by Rp 1.8 million for the period from July to September 2021.

"KPDJ and KAJ recipients receive assistance by Rp 900,000 per person for the same period," he stated.

As informed, it is a basic social assistance in the form of cash. For KLJ, it is Rp 600,000 per person per month for one year, as well as KPDJ and KAJ recipients receive Rp 300,000 per person every month for one year.
